Best Bowling Alleys In Modesto & Stockton

Whether you want to join a league, get some practice in at the lanes, or just have some fun the best Modesto and Stockton bowling alleys and centers are ready whenever you are:

Mcherny Bowl offers 52 lanes where fall adult and senior leagues, fall evening leagues, and youth leagues are held throughout the week along with monthly tournaments. There’s also cosmic bowling, an arcade, and a pub.

Yosemite Lanes is open daily from 8am until 3am with 32 lanes that host local summer bowling leagues and tournaments throughout the week. You will also find cosmic bowling, a bar, and a pro shop on the premises.

West Lane Bowl hosts leagues for people of all ages while having a sports bar and on-site pro shop.

Pacific Avenue Bowl is open from 9am to 12am Sunday through Thursday and from 9am to 1am on weekend nights. Every year they hold an annual adult winter league and an annual new year low ball competition.

On Tuesday afternoons Stockton Bowling Lanes hosts a junior league and a mixed league plus they are a good place to find cosmic bowling in your area after dark.
